Output d36d49689896e97df32e5269522e0470250c3378f780d4cd56d73476dfb158d6:4

value
24510969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39e4c5b6574e1789def8440a0ac7c15ad16b3bf8 OP_EQUAL
address
MDBGok5Vjnm3aqWfxz3ZJm25Wd41rdq69g
transaction
d36d49689896e97df32e5269522e0470250c3378f780d4cd56d73476dfb158d6
spent
true